Good write up buddy

Few tips if you don't mind.

There is no need to remove the window frame at all.
I've changed glass, handles, soft close latches and entire wiring on front and rear door and I have never ever touched the frame and no, it doesn't take longer with frame in, it's probably quicker.

In regards to electric blinds, yes, the service mode is a b1tch so I found the way to remove them without the need of service mode, again really simple and easy.

Also replacing rear or front door top chrome trim is easy without the need of removing window frame.

FYI, non of these methods requires breaking or cutting bits so after the job is done everything is as it was before.
